    • Techniques to support fast state transition by a user equipment (UE) are described. The UE may operate in a first state (e.g., a CELL_PCH state) in which the UE does not transmit or receive user data. The UE may receive a paging message carrying first configuration information. The UE may transition from the first state to a second state (e.g., a CELL_DCH state) in response to receiving the paging message. The UE may determine a set of communication parameters based on the first configuration information received from the paging message and second configuration information stored at the UE. The UE may then exchange user data based on the set of communication parameters. The UE may use default values for some parameters in order to reduce the amount of first configuration information to send in the paging message.
